Could this guard account for final classes with metaclasses that override
__eq__? A value pattern compares with==, not identity, sotype(inst)can fail to match the class at runtime even when its nominal type is exact; removing it here could incorrectly suppress an exhaustive-match diagnostic. Please add coverage and retain the subtype when equality semantics are nonstandard.
